Temple Town Wedding Season Begins – What to Know
There is a certain magic to weddings in temple towns. It begins before the first nadashwaram note fills the air. It is there in the fragrance of fresh jasmine, the rustle of silk sarees, the sound of family members calling each other across a busy morning, and the anticipation of a wedding that feels like more than a celebration.
In Tamil Nadu, temple towns have long been woven into the story of weddings. Cities such as Madurai and Kanchipuram bring together centuries-old architecture, living traditions, distinctive food, and a sense of place that makes every celebration feel deeply rooted.
And when the wedding season begins, these towns come alive.
If you are planning a wedding in a temple town—or travelling to one as a guest—here is what to know before the invitations go out and the suitcases come down from the loft.
Why Temple Town Weddings Feel So Special
A wedding can happen anywhere. But a temple town gives it a backdrop with a story of its own.
Think of waking up to a city that has been welcoming pilgrims, travellers and families for generations. Think colourful streets, towering gopurams, flower sellers arranging jasmine by the handful, and traditional breakfast served hot enough to bring everyone around the table.
That is the charm of a temple town wedding.
Kanchipuram, for instance, is synonymous with temples, silk and heritage. The city is home to landmarks including Kamakshi Amman Temple, Kailasanatha Temple and Ekambaranathar Temple, making it a natural choice for families looking to combine a wedding celebration with a meaningful cultural experience.
Madurai, meanwhile, carries its own unmistakable rhythm. At the heart of the city stands the Meenakshi Amman Temple, whose legends and festivals have been part of Madurai’s cultural identity for generations. The celebrated Meenakshi Thirukalyanam adds another layer of wedding symbolism to a city already known for grand celebrations.
In other words, the destination isn't simply where the wedding happens. The destination becomes part of the wedding.
First Things First: Understand the Wedding Season
Temple town weddings often follow the rhythms of the traditional calendar, so dates can become especially important.
Before finalising a venue, accommodation or travel arrangements, families should check auspicious dates with their family priest or wedding planner and then start coordinating the practical details around them.
Popular wedding dates can mean high demand for:
- Wedding halls and banquet spaces
- Guest accommodation
- Transport
- Makeup and styling professionals
- Photographers and decorators
- Caterers and traditional wedding service providers
And this matters particularly when a wedding involves guests travelling from different cities. A little advance planning can make the difference between a celebration that feels beautifully effortless and one where everyone is constantly checking the clock.

Food Deserves a Place on the Wedding Checklist
Let us be honest: no one travels all the way to Tamil Nadu and leaves without talking about the food.
Temple town weddings are an opportunity to make regional cuisine part of the experience.
From a traditional breakfast of idli, vada and pongal to elaborate wedding meals served on banana leaves, food can become one of the most memorable threads running through the celebration.
And it does not have to stop with the wedding feast.
Think evening filter coffee for travelling guests. A spread of local sweets. A leisurely South Indian lunch between ceremonies. A dinner that introduces out-of-town guests to flavours they may not have encountered before.
